Transaction 704d16b8223bf54f831e794dbd73df49a5821882f88cc684fe82a4339a496e16

1 Input
1 Outputs
  • 704d16b8223bf54f831e794dbd73df49a5821882f88cc684fe82a4339a496e16:0
  • value  5161734
    address  3LuWimm9YW1qGqVE2GavGdBZ4VT59jdZzi